Director of Catering and Conference Services
Compensation: $90,000 per year plus bonus
DIRECTOR OF CATERING & CONFERENCE SERVICES
PRIMARY OBJECTIVE OF POSITION:
Job Overview: We are seeking a dynamic and experienced Catering and Conference Services Sales Director or Manager to lead the sales and marketing strategies for our catering department. In this role, you will be responsible for securing new accounts, maintaining existing ones, and executing tactical plans to maximize hotel profitability while ensuring guest satisfaction.
RESPONSIBILITIES AND JOB DUTIES:
- Direct day-to-day activities of the catering and conference services team, advising on policies and procedures.
- Develop, train, and motivate a catering team to achieve revenue goals and maximize profits.
- Establish a client base through direct outside sales efforts, producing and reviewing all sales contracts and agreements.
- Conduct facility tours and entertain clients; assist with menu planning and event details.
- Conduct the role of conference services manager during high group demand periods.
- Review daily charges, resolving discrepancies promptly; ensure guest satisfaction.
- Plan and conduct pre-event and post-event meetings with clients, guests, and staff.
- Achieve budgeted revenues and personal sales goals; assist in preparing the annual departmental operating budget.
- Negotiate prices and services within guidelines, collaborating with the Executive Chef on menu design.
- Identify and solve operational problems affecting catering and conference services sales performance.
- Promote teamwork through communication with other departments and key contacts.
- Interact with guests, vendors, and other contacts as needed.
- Accurately forecast banquet and catering revenues.
- Maintain property’s Amadeus Delphi inventories and pricing.
- Develop an annual catering and banquet budget with supporting strategies to reach revenue targets.
- Recommend staffing and HR-related actions in accordance with Company rules.
- Perform other duties as assigned.

InterContinental Minneapolis-St. Paul Airport
Hotel with 291 Rooms
Modern Hotel With Unrivaled Convenience at Minneapolis – St. Paul Airport
The only hotel at MSP International Airport, the InterContinental Minneapolis - St. Paul Airport is a confluence of luxury and convenience. Direct access from Terminal 1 is available at Gate C25 and our free 24-hour shuttle expedites transfers from both terminals. Steps away from light rail access, the Mall of America and Downtown Minneapolis are only minutes away.
